Definition
οὐ is the primary negative particle in Ancient Greek, meaning “not” or “no.” It is used to negate a statement (often before the verb in the indicative and related forms), contrasting with μή, which marks non-factual or potential negation.

Grammatical Analysis
"ου"
Function: negating particle used primarily with the indicative mood and in direct statements; expresses objective or factual negation (‘not’).
